Eli Broad, the billionaire philanthropist dies at 87.

Eli Broad, the billionaire philanthropist died Friday in Los Angeles. He was 87. He was an entrepreneur who co-founded homebuilding pioneer Kaufman and Broad Inc. and launched financial services giant SunAmerica Inc.,

Gerun Riley, president of The Eli and Edythe Broad Foundation, said in a statement Friday-

“As a businessman Eli saw around corners, as a philanthropist he saw the problems in the world and tried to fix them, as a citizen he saw the possibility in our shared community, and as a husband, father and friend he saw the potential in each of us,”

Broad, one of Los Angeles' most influential figures. The billionaire poured his wealth into reshaping L.A. He created a flourishing downtown area of expensive lofts, fancy dining establishments and civic structures like the landmark Walt Disney Concert Hall, MOCA and more..

Los Angeles Mayor Eric Garcetti said on Twitter-

“Eli Broad, simply put, was L.A.’s most influential private citizen of his generation,”.
“He loved this city as deeply as anyone I have ever known.”
